Users receive an error message when trying to connect. Solution: This typically happens when the hex values modified do not match your exact Windows build version. Restore your backup file using the command prompt:
Universal Termsrv.dll Patch Windows 10: Enable Concurrent RDP Sessions
Modifying core system files can introduce stability issues or expose your system to BlueKeep-style RDP vulnerabilities. Never download automated patchers from untrusted, third-party shady websites, as they often bundle malware or trojans inside the executables. 3. Violation of EULA
While patching this file unlocks enterprise-level features for free, it comes with severe disadvantages that you must consider before proceeding. 1. Windows Update Instability universal termsrv.dll patch windows 10
Create a backup copy named termsrv.dll.bak in a safe location.
Save the modified file back to System32 , then restart the service using net start termservice . Troubleshooting Common Issues 1. Windows Update Breaks the Patch
RDP Wrapper is a popular open-source alternative. Unlike a direct patch, it does not modify the termsrv.dll on disk. Instead, it loads a wrapper library that intercepts and modifies the function calls made to termsrv.dll in memory. This approach can be more resilient to Windows Updates, though updates can still break the wrapper, requiring an updated configuration file ( rdpwrap.ini ). The is an excellent alternative as it leaves the original system file untouched. Users receive an error message when trying to connect
Then, verify your exact Windows build via the winver command and source a patch matching that specific version. Issue 3: Local Account Restrictions
To:
If you are using a manual hex editor (such as HxD), you need to look up the exact hex signature corresponding to your specific Windows 10 build version (e.g., 21H2, 22H2). Because Microsoft updates this file regularly, the exact bytes to change vary per build. Never download automated patchers from untrusted
Patching this file essentially tricks Windows 10 into behaving like Windows Server, which allows multiple concurrent users. This is useful for: Running shared home servers.
Provide instructions on how to backup termsrv.dll via Command Prompt. Suggest tools to safely manage system file permissions. Let me know how you'd like to proceed. Share public link
By altering just 3-6 bytes, the patch effectively neuters the session limit mechanism.
. It sits between the service and the DLL, making it easier to maintain during Windows updates. 🔧 Group Policy Tweaks